 Mom pleads guilty in cult starvation death
Mom pleads guilty in cult starvation death
A religious cult member accused of starving her 1-year-old son to death is making an unusual deal with prosecutors — she wants her guilty plea to be withdrawn if her child is resurrected. picked by suebe 8 months ago
